Transaction e5132bc741786192151bdcc00d7a2bc2e12443d49834e03f2a81a3c7d7dafd11

1 Input
2 Outputs
  • e5132bc741786192151bdcc00d7a2bc2e12443d49834e03f2a81a3c7d7dafd11:0
  • value  5000000
    address  18E67yBcmw6KJYo8kViBAN4yfF6Jjg57wx
  • e5132bc741786192151bdcc00d7a2bc2e12443d49834e03f2a81a3c7d7dafd11:1
  • value  1398170
    address  3FUcTQa2XWHfnCZQmUWEU18xQQeMuMuVgJ